How to Choose

When selecting a laptop, start by defining your primary use case. Creative professionals benefit from high‑resolution displays and dedicated graphics, while students often prioritize battery life and weight. Pay attention to the processor generation; newer CPUs provide better performance per watt, which translates to longer battery life and cooler operation.

Memory and storage also play a critical role. Aim for at least 16 GB of RAM if you plan to run multiple applications simultaneously, and choose SSDs over HDDs for faster boot and load times. Finally, consider build quality and warranty support, especially if you travel frequently. A sturdy chassis, good keyboard, and reliable after‑sales service can extend the lifespan of your investment.
